What you'll see and do

  1. Mutianyu Great Wall

    Your friendly private tour guide and driver will meet you in your hotel lobby. Then you will be transferred to the No.1 highlight in Beijing is Mutianyu Great Wall. Explore The world UNESCO heritages. The Mutianyu Great Wall is one of the best-preserved and No.1 rated site in Beijing surrounded by lush vegetation, this section of the wall is most beloved Great Wall in China by families and hikers but less people. It offers breathtaking views of mountainous, orchard and villages. You will spend about 2 hours wandering around and hiking on the Great Wall leisurely. Listen innumerable stories of this amazing wonder of the world from your private guide. Enjoy cable car up and cable car down from the Great Wall or with an exciting option of tobogganing down from the Great Wall of China. ( Toboggan at your own expenses) An unforgettable experience perfect both for adults and kids.

    120 minutes here · Admission included

  2. Bell and Drum Towers

    Savor a delightful lunch. Continue your tour to Hutong. Stroll along the Yandai Xie Street, Back Lakes (Houhai), Shichahai Scenic Resort, Hou Lake, Yinding bridges (money bridge) and Jinding Bridge. Admire the fancy newly renovated courtyards along the Jade River.

    Pass by without stopping

  3. Back Lakes (Hou Hai)

    This area of Beijing contains some of the most extensive old hutong neighborhood and the three lakes of Xihai, Houhai and Qianhai. The most hippy area for people enjoy the nightlife.

    20 minutes here

  4. Yandai Xie Street

    Beijing's oldest commercial street, It is lined in traditional-style stone buildings that house charming souvenir and handicraft shops. At the end of the tour, your tour guide will transfer you back to your lovely hotel.

    20 minutes here
